Product details

Overview

MCZ33977EG from Freescale Semiconductor is a SPI-controlled single-gauge stepper motor driver IC designed for automotive and industrial instrumentation systems. It integrates dual H-bridge coil drivers, a 4096-position state machine, air-core pointer movement emulation, and analog microstepping (12 steps/degree), delivering precise 340° pointer sweep with up to 400°/s velocity and 4500°/s² acceleration in applications such as analog dashboard gauges.

Technical Context

The MCZ33977EG implements a fully integrated two-phase stepper motor control architecture with on-chip state machine logic that autonomously manages acceleration, deceleration, and position tracking using quantized time-step tables referenced to a calibrated 1.0 MHz internal oscillator. Its dual H-bridge outputs (SIN+/SIN−, COS+/COS−) deliver four-quadrant current control with 40 mA continuous per output and programmable ILIM (40–170 mA).

It features dedicated RTZ (Return to Zero) multiplexed output for non-driven coil monitoring, VPWR undervoltage/overvoltage detection (5.0–6.2 V UV, 26–38 V OV), and thermal shutdown at 155–180°C with 8–16°C hysteresis - all operating across −40°C to +125°C ambient with 5.0 V logic supply (VDD) and 6.5–26 V battery input (VPWR).

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Control Interface SPI (16-bit messages, 1.0–2.0 MHz max clock, CS/SCLK/SI/SO/RST signals)
Output Drive Capability Dual H-bridge with 40 mA continuous per coil output; supports Switec MS-X15.xxx and MMT-licensed AFIC 6405 motors
Pointer Resolution 4096 steady-state positions; 340° mechanical sweep; analog microstepping at 12 steps/degree
Dynamic Performance Max pointer velocity = 400°/s; max acceleration = 4500°/s²; turn-on/off delay ≤1.0 ms
Supply Ranges VDD = 4.5–5.5 V (5.0 V nominal); VPWR = 6.5–26 V (fully operational), −0.3 to 41 V (absolute max)
Thermal & Protection Overtemperature shutdown at 155–180°C; undervoltage lockout at 5.0–6.2 V; overvoltage disable at 26–38 V
Package & Compliance 24-pin SOICW (DW suffix); Pb-free packaging designated by EG suffix; JEDEC J-STD-020C reflow compliant

Pinout & Package

MCZ33977EG is housed in a 24-pin Small Outline Integrated Circuit Wide-body (SOICW) package with exposed thermal pad (not electrically connected), rated for −40°C to +125°C operation. Pin 1 is marked via notch or dot; pins 5–8 and 17–20 are GND; pins 21–24 are NC (no connect).

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
COS+, COS− H-Bridge Output Pair Drive cosine coil of two-phase stepper motor; provide four-quadrant current sourcing/sinking
SIN+, SIN− H-Bridge Output Pair Drive sine coil of two-phase stepper motor; enable precise angular positioning via vector synthesis
GND (Pins 5–8, 17–20) Power Ground Eight dedicated ground connections ensure low-impedance return paths for motor and logic currents
CS Digital Input Chip select enables SPI communication; latches data on rising edge; tri-states SO when high
SCLK, SI, SO SPI Interface SCLK clocks data; SI receives 16-bit commands on falling edge; SO outputs status/data on rising edge
RST Reset Input Active-low reset forces default logic state; internal pull-up ensures defined startup behavior
RTZ Multiplexed Output Provides voltage from non-driven coil during Return-to-Zero sequence for closed-loop calibration
VDD Logic Supply 5.0 V ±5% supply for SPI interface and internal logic; separate from VPWR to isolate noise
VPWR Battery Input Main power rail (6.5–26 V) for H-bridge drivers; includes UV/OV detection circuitry

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Integrated Pointer State Machine Autonomously executes acceleration/deceleration profiles without MCU intervention - reduces processor overhead in cluster gauge systems
Air-Core Movement Emulation Reproduces damped pointer motion characteristics of legacy air-core meters, easing mechanical redesign in digital instrument clusters
Analog Microstepping 12 microsteps per degree enables smooth, jitter-free pointer motion - critical for high-fidelity analog-style displays
Return-to-Zero (RTZ) Calibration Hardware-supported RTZ sequence uses multiplexed RTZ pin to detect zero position via back-EMF, enabling self-calibration
Internal Calibratable Oscillator 1.0 MHz nominal clock (±30% uncalibrated, ±10% calibrated) eliminates need for external crystal - lowers BOM cost and board space

Applications

Automotive Instrument Cluster Gauges Industrial Panel Meters

Use Scenario: Driving analog-style speedometer, tachometer, and fuel level indicators in modern vehicle dashboards.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Single-gauge driver IC executing closed-loop stepper positioning with air-core emulation and RTZ calibration.

Use Value: Enables drop-in replacement of air-core meters while maintaining OEM aesthetic and tactile response - no firmware changes needed in host MCU.

Use Scenario: Precision needle-based readouts in factory HMIs, energy monitors, and test equipment requiring stable, repeatable positioning.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Standalone gauge controller managing full acceleration/deceleration profile and 4096-position resolution.

Use Value: Eliminates need for external microcontroller-based motion control - reduces system latency and component count in embedded panel designs.

Switec MS-X15.xxx Motor Replacement MMT-Licensed AFIC 6405 Systems

Use Scenario: Upgrading legacy Switec MS-X15.xxx-based gauges with enhanced microstepping and thermal protection.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Direct-compatible driver IC supporting identical coil interface and timing constraints of Switec motors.

Use Value: Maintains mechanical compatibility while adding diagnostics (UV/OV/OT), SPI configurability, and improved pointer smoothness.

Use Scenario: Supporting instrumentation systems built around MMT-licensed AFIC 6405 stepper motors in aerospace or medical devices.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Certified functional replacement for AFIC 6405 drive requirements with extended VPWR range and fault detection.

Use Value: Provides extended operating temperature (−40°C to +125°C) and robust protection features not available in original AFIC implementation.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ar single-gauge stepper motor driver appl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
NXP MC33977DW/R2 Same die, 24-pin SOICW package with DW (lead-based) suffix; identical electrical specs and pinout; lacks Pb-free compliance Acceptable where RoHS exemption applies; requires leaded solder process; same thermal and timing behavior Select MC33977DW/R2 only if Pb-free manufacturing is not required and legacy leaded assembly is in place.
ON Semiconductor NCV33977DWR2G Pin-compatible successor post-Freescale acquisition; adds enhanced ESD rating (±4 kV HBM), tighter VPWR UV threshold (5.3 V min), and updated qualification per AEC-Q100 Grade 1 Preferred for new automotive designs requiring latest reliability standards and extended ESD robustness Choose NCV33977DWR2G for new production programs targeting AEC-Q100 compliance and higher field reliability.

Compared with MCZ33977EG, the MC33977DW/R2 offers identical functionality without Pb-free compliance, while the NCV33977DWR2G delivers upgraded automotive qualification and ESD performance - making it the recommended long-term alternative for new designs.

FAQ

What is the primary function of the MCZ33977EG in an automotive instrument cluster?

The MCZ33977EG serves as a dedicated single-gauge stepper motor driver IC that replaces traditional air-core meters with precise, software-controlled analog-style needle movement. It autonomously executes acceleration/deceleration profiles, supports 4096-position resolution, and emulates damped pointer motion - all while interfacing via SPI to the host MCU. This allows the MCZ33977EG to reduce processor overhead and maintain OEM-grade visual fidelity in modern dashboards.

Does the MCZ33977EG require an external crystal or oscillator?

No, the MCZ33977EG does not require an external crystal or oscillator. It features an internal calibrated oscillator with nominal 1.0 MHz frequency (±10% after calibration), which drives all timing-critical functions including microstepping, state machine sequencing, and SPI timing. The oscillator can be calibrated using an 8.0 µs pulse on the PECCR register, eliminating BOM cost and board space associated with external timing components.

How does the MCZ33977EG handle overvoltage and undervoltage conditions on the VPWR rail?

The MCZ33977EG incorporates dedicated VPWR undervoltage and overvoltage detection circuitry. It asserts undervoltage lockout when VPWR falls below 5.0–6.2 V (typical 5.6 V), keeping outputs active but potentially limiting drive strength. It disables outputs when VPWR exceeds 26–38 V (typical 32 V) and requires re-enablement via the PECCR command. These thresholds protect both the MCZ33977EG and connected motor coils under battery transients common in automotive environments.

Can the MCZ33977EG drive motors other than Switec MS-X15.xxx?

Yes, the MCZ33977EG is explicitly licensed for MMT-licensed two-phase stepper motors and is compatible with Switec MS-X15.xxx series motors. Its dual H-bridge outputs (SIN±/COS±), 40 mA continuous per phase, and 4096-position state machine support any two-phase instrumentation stepper motor meeting its voltage, current, and coil impedance specifications - including custom or AFIC 6405-derived variants - provided microstep alignment and timing constraints are observed.

What is the role of the RTZ pin on the MCZ33977EG, and how is it used?

The RTZ pin on the MCZ33977EG is a multiplexed output used exclusively during the Return-to-Zero (RTZ) calibration sequence. During RTZ, it presents the voltage from the non-driven coil, allowing the host MCU to detect zero-crossing or back-EMF for precise mechanical zero-point identification. This hardware-assisted calibration enables self-alignment without external sensors, ensuring long-term accuracy in automotive and industrial gauge applications where thermal drift or mechanical wear may affect pointer home position.
